126www.nigoodfood.com | Guide 2013The Boathouse££What a fantastic location for a restaurant? It’s quite literally in thewater at Bangor Harbour. The clue is in the name. It was the old boathouse. These days, the boats bring the catch from mere metresaway. Crabs, mussels, lobster, scallops…Don’t you feel hungry?All <strong>of</strong> the cheeses are Irish. Most <strong>of</strong> them come straight from theproducers. All <strong>of</strong> the meat is from fine suppliers like Hannans andKettyle. Vegetables are straight from the farm. They grow theirown herbs, micro herbs and edible flowers. They use GoatsbridgeIrish caviar. All <strong>of</strong> the game is from local hunstmen. Get the picture?These guys are major foodies. Local brews, juices, cider and c<strong>of</strong>feetoo.Most people want to try as much as they can, so the 5 and 7 coursetaster menus are the most popular. Loving the sound <strong>of</strong> panroasted brill with edible sand and myriad other accompanyingtastes <strong>of</strong> the sea. But there’s similar fare on a £20 two course lunchmenu.
